Residing in New College West Residential College, Residential Life Coordinator Nia Pierce assists in cultivating a welcoming and cohesive residential community. RLC Nia supports and promotes the health, safety and well-being of students in New College West . By residing in the college and being readily available to respond to crises and urgent situations, Nia helps to create and maintain a safe and supportive residential environment for all students. In addition, RLC Nia develops and implements programs and activities that foster a sense of community, well-being, and belonging among college residents and assists in developing the skills required to navigate the opportunities and challenges of living and learning within the University community successfully.
Nia attended the College of New Jersey, where she received her Bachelor's in Music Education with a harp studies minor. She is now obtaining her Master's in Education Policy-Law and Policy from Columbia University.
Nia enjoys traveling, practicing her harp, and spending time with friends and family.
